David Inglish to get Academy’s Bonner Medal

Jan 03, 2008 by Ian Evans

David Inglish has been voted the John A. Bonner Medal of Commendation by the Board of Governors of the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ences. The award —- a medallion —- will be presented at the Scientific and Technical Achievement Awards Dinner on Saturday, February 9, at The Beverly Wilshire.

“For decades, Dave has conceived, designed and implemented an amazing array of technology-based projects,” said Academy President Sid Ganis. “His commitment and expertise are truly admirable as is his unfailing dedication to the Academy.”

Inglish has been an Academy member since 1992 and has served in the Visual Effects Branch since its inception. He is also a longtime member of the Scientific and Technical Awards Committee. In 2003, he became one of the founding members of the Academy’s Science and Technology Council.
